Output 3ec93720cca9138be4e27a8ed177259d2a8321548e4004a197eb14e80e9c2868:0

value
1459186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f050097264727611126a908da70c54db3be5511 OP_EQUAL
address
34X2s4FT1xX6p29qT8hM5xCNJqX2ocpvww
transaction
3ec93720cca9138be4e27a8ed177259d2a8321548e4004a197eb14e80e9c2868
spent
true